Biological Background: SMPD4 Function and Localization
- SMPD4 (Sphingomyelin phosphodiesterase 4), also known as nSMase-3, SKNY, NET13, is encoded by the SMPD4 gene and produces isoforms via alternative splicing.
- Catalyzes the hydrolysis of sphingomyelin to ceramide and phosphorylcholine, regulating membrane sphingolipid homeostasis (PubMed:16517606, PubMed:25180167). Related references: PMID:16517606, PMID:25180167
- Plays a role in endoplasmic reticulum organization and function, influencing membrane integrity (PubMed:31495489). Related references: PMID:31495489
- May sensitize cells to DNA damage-induced apoptosis (PubMed:18505924). Related references: PMID:18505924
- In skeletal muscle, mediates TNF-stimulated oxidant production (By similarity).
- Localizes to the endoplasmic reticulum membrane, Golgi apparatus membrane, nuclear envelope, cell membrane, and sarcolemma.
- Widely expressed, with highest levels in heart and skeletal muscle; detected in skeletal muscle at the protein level.
- Associated with intellectual disability (disease variant).
Experimental Guidance and Technical Tips
- The immunogen is a recombinant fusion protein corresponding to amino acids 600-800 of human SMPD4 (NP_060421.2). For assay optimization, consider performing epitope mapping or using this region for specificity controls.
- SMPD4 is a multi-pass transmembrane protein with a predicted molecular weight of ~98 kDa. Ensure appropriate membrane protein extraction protocols and include positive controls (e.g., heart or skeletal muscle lysates).
- For Western blot, consider using a reducing agent and heating to ensure full denaturation of the transmembrane domains.
- The antibody is validated for WB, IF/ICC, and ELISA with human and mouse samples. Perform cross-reactivity validation in your specific experimental model.
- For IF/ICC, permeabilization may be required to detect ER/Golgi/nuclear envelope localization; suitable fixation methods should be tested.
